๐ฏ What is Responsible Gaming?
Responsible gaming means enjoying gambling as entertainment while maintaining control over the time and money you spend. It involves understanding the risks and making informed decisions about your gambling activities.
๐ฐ
Budget Control
Set spending limits you can afford and stick to them. Never gamble with money needed for essentials.
โฐ
Time Management
Set time limits for gambling sessions. Don't let gambling interfere with work, family, or other responsibilities.
๐ง
Stay Informed
Understand the games you play, including odds and house edges. Knowledge helps you make better decisions.
๐
Emotional Control
Never gamble when upset, stressed, or under the influence. Make decisions with a clear mind.
โ ๏ธ Warning Signs of Problem Gambling
It's important to recognize the warning signs of problem gambling in yourself or others. Early recognition can help prevent serious consequences.
Behavioral Signs:
- Spending more time and money gambling than intended
- Lying to family and friends about gambling activities
- Borrowing money or selling possessions to fund gambling
- Neglecting work, family, or personal responsibilities
- Chasing losses with bigger bets
- Feeling restless or irritable when not gambling
- Unsuccessful attempts to control or stop gambling
Emotional Signs:
- Gambling to escape problems or negative emotions
- Feeling guilty, anxious, or depressed about gambling
- Mood swings related to wins and losses
- Preoccupation with gambling thoughts
- Loss of interest in other activities
Financial Signs:
- Unable to pay bills or meet financial obligations
- Maxing out credit cards or taking loans
- Hiding financial statements or debts
- Frequent requests for money from family/friends
๐ค Self-Assessment Questions
Ask yourself these honest questions about your gambling habits:
- Do you gamble longer than you originally planned?
- Have you ever lied about your gambling activities?
- Do you gamble to win back money you've lost?
- Has gambling caused problems in your relationships?
- Do you think about gambling frequently?
- Have you tried to stop gambling but couldn't?
- Do you gamble when feeling stressed or upset?
- Have you borrowed money to fund gambling?
If you answered "yes" to several questions, consider seeking help from a gambling support organization.
๐ ๏ธ Self-Help Tools and Strategies
There are many practical tools and strategies you can use to maintain control over your gambling activities.
๐ข Self-Exclusion Programs
Self-exclusion is a powerful tool that allows you to restrict your access to gambling sites and venues for a specified period.
๐ Individual Site Exclusion
Most reputable online casinos offer self-exclusion options directly through their platforms:
- Temporary exclusions (24 hours to 6 months)
- Permanent self-exclusion options
- Account closure with cooling-off periods
- Marketing material opt-out
๐ก๏ธ Multi-Operator Exclusion
Industry-wide exclusion programs that cover multiple operators:
- GAMSTOP (UK): Free self-exclusion across all UK licensed sites
- GamBlock: Software that blocks access to gambling sites
- Net Nanny: Parental control software for blocking content
- Cold Turkey: Website and application blocker
How to Self-Exclude:
- Contact the Operator: Use live chat, email, or phone
- Specify Duration: Choose your exclusion period
- Confirm Identity: Provide verification documents
- Remove Temptations: Delete apps and bookmarks
- Seek Support: Consider professional counseling

Treatment Options:
-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Helps change thought patterns and behaviors
- Support Groups: Connect with others facing similar challenges
- Individual Counseling: One-on-one sessions with trained professionals
- Family Therapy: Involves family members in the recovery process
- Residential Treatment: Intensive programs for severe cases
- Online Support: Virtual counseling and support groups
๐จโ๐ฉโ๐งโ๐ฆ Support for Family and Friends
Problem gambling affects not just the individual but also their family and friends. Support is available for loved ones too.
How to Help a Loved One:
- Stay Calm: Approach the topic with care and understanding
- Avoid Enabling: Don't lend money or cover gambling debts
- Encourage Professional Help: Suggest counseling or support groups
- Set Boundaries: Protect your own financial and emotional well-being
- Seek Support: Consider counseling for yourself
- Remove Temptations: Help eliminate access to gambling
Family Support Resources:
- GamAnon: Support groups for families of problem gamblers
- Family Counseling: Professional therapy for affected families
- Educational Materials: Books and resources about problem gambling
- Online Forums: Connect with other families facing similar issues
